It’s bad enough when a full back in a flat back 4 plays a forward onside. It typically means there’s bad communication between CBs and FBs and/or the FB isn’t paying attention and has his finger up his arse.

For a wing back to play a forward onside in a 3-5-2 is unforgivable. It shows a complete lack of concentration and appreciation for what is going on around you. It means you are in completely the wrong position on the field and are generally clueless. Whether you apportion the blame to the clueless player, or apportion it to the manager who put said clueless player in that position is up for debate.
